## Scanwright 4.2 — Changed defaults

Breaking for plugin authors. Barcode scanner integration now defaults to continuous-scan mode; single-shot must be requested explicitly. Symbology auto-detect is on by default, and the legacy beep callback is removed. Plugins targeting 4.1 behavior must pin the compatibility flag before init. New defaults ship as listed in the configuration below.

config for fajof-badug:
holael:
  log_level: error
  metrics_host: metrics.holael.tolvaqsys.internal
  pool_size: 32

## Authentication

The Brightgate circuit breaker sits in front of the Oxbow upstream API and enforces its own authentication layer, separate from the upstream's credentials. Plugin authors must present a valid token on every call, including half-open probe requests; unauthenticated probes are counted as failures and will trip the breaker faster. Tokens are scoped to a single breaker instance and expire after 24 hours, so plan your refresh logic accordingly. For sandbox testing, authenticate with the bearer token below.

session JWT of hahif-fawif = eyJhbGciOiJIUzI1NiIsInR5cCI6IkpXVCJ9.eyJzdWIiOiI04_V2KayaDIn0.-jKHPhS5t5LS

### Broker Upgrade — Step 4: Credential swap

During the Quillbus upgrade from 3.8 to 4.0, the broker's auth plugin changes its token format, so pre-upgrade credentials are invalidated at restart. Consumers reconnect automatically once the new credential is in place; producers must be drained first. For audit purposes, the old key is revoked immediately, not retired. The replacement key for the internal broker admin endpoint is provided below.

service key, fawip-bajef: kto11_Qt5wZK9vdNC